ARCHITECTURAL COMMENTS Note and specify that shower area walls shall be finished with a non-absorbent surface to a height of six feet above the floor. Ref. IRC Section 307.2. For skylights specify materials and provide note for compliance with IRC R308.6.9. An attic access opening shall be provided to attic areas that exceed 30 s.f. and have a vertical height of 30 inches or greater. The rough-framed opening shall not be less than 22 inches by 30 inches and shall be located in a hallway or other readily accessible location. A 30 inch minimum unobstructed headroom in the attic space shall be provided at some point above the access opening. Ref. IRC Section R807.1. Opening between the garage and residence shall be equipped with solid wood doors not less than 1 3/8 inch thick, or shall be 20-minute fire rated doors and shall be maintained self-closing and self-latching. Amendment to IRC Section R309.1. Indicate self latching requirement on Sheet A-200. Glass in hazardous areas shall be safety glass. Specify on applicable floor plans and elevations. Ref. IRC Section 308.4. Address sliding glass doors, window W4. Provide attic ventilation calculations for all concealed attic spaces; include required and provided net free ventilation area. Also, indicate the type and location of attic ventilation. Provide the following note, if applicable: “Where eave or cornice vents are installed insulation shall not block the free flow of air. A minimum of 1 inch space shall be provided between the insulation and roof sheathing at the location of the vent” (non-vented roof design may be used with a registrant’s seal or meeting the TEP guidelines as agreed by the Greater Tucson Jurisdictions). Ref. IRC Section R806. Note and specify termite protection. Ref. IRC Section R320.1. Note and specify surface drainage. Ref. IRC Section R401.3. Demonstrate dining and kitchen still comply with light/ ventilation requirements due to removal of existing kitchen window. Ref. IRC R303. PLUMBING COMMENTS Provide a drainage pipe isometric showing all drain, waste and vent piping or reflect in the plan view that vents are taken off downstream of the traps. Note that drainage piping serving fixtures which have floor level rims located below the elevation of the next upstream manhole cover of the public sewer shall be protected from backflow of sewage by a backwater valve. Ref. IRC Section P3008. Clarify what materials/ methods are to be used to comply with plumbing note 12. Address HVAC unit similarly. Ref. IRC M1307.3. Indicate size of water meter and length of piping from meter to most remote fixture in order to confirm existing meter and building supply piping are of sufficient size. MECHANICAL COMMENTS Show that ducts meet the minimum material requirements of IRC Section M1602 and provide sizing of return air as stipulated in IRC M1403.1 (6sq inches/ 1000 btu). Also reflect duct material requirements for ducts in garages per IRC M1601.3.7. Show fan over water closet as shown on Sheet E-100. Revise mechanical note 12 to reflect 2003 IRC. Indicate the minimum R values of insulation to be used on both the supply and return air ducts in conditioned and non-conditioned spaces. Ref. IRC N1103. Denote requirement for duct sealing per IRC N1103.4. ELECTRICAL COMMENTS Revise circuit identification numbers to reflect all branch circuits installed in dwelling unit bedrooms shall be protected by an arc-fault circuit interrupter(s). Ref. NEC Article 210-12(b), IRC Section E3802.11. This shall include lighting outlets in bedroom and lights and receptacles in adjacent closets. Indicate light fixtures in shower to comply with IRC E3903.9. Reflect bonding requirements per IRC E4109.4 for hydro-massage tub. Hydro massage tub cannot be on the 20 amp bath receptacle circuit. Also show access panel to motor per IRC E4109.3. Surface mounted incandescent light fixtures in clothes closets shall maintain 12 inches between the fixture and the nearest point of storage. Ref. IRC Section E3903.11. Delete hall receptacle from bedroom arc fault circuit to avoid mislabeled panel circuit. Provide disconnect for hot water heater per IRC Table E4001.1. Revise disconnect rating at exterior HVAC to reflect 40amp rating and interior to be 20amp. Revise circuit breaker sizing in panel similarly.
